About agriculture in Bulutçeker
Bulutçeker is located in the Diyarbakır province of southeastern Turkey, situated within the vast and historically significant plains of Upper Mesopotamia. The surrounding landscape is characterized by expansive agricultural fields that stretch toward the horizon, punctuated by the rolling hills typical of the Anatolian plateau. The area benefits from a Mediterranean-influenced continental climate, which provides fertile ground for large-scale farming operations.
Agriculture in this region is the backbone of the local economy, with a strong focus on cereal production such as wheat and barley. Thanks to modern irrigation projects, the area also supports the cultivation of cotton, corn, and various legumes. Livestock farming, particularly sheep and goat rearing, remains a traditional and vital component of the rural landscape, utilizing the surrounding pasture lands for grazing.
For agronomists and seasonal farm workers, Bulutçeker offers opportunities primarily centered around the planting and harvesting cycles of major field crops. Peak demand for labor typically occurs during the summer months for cotton and grain harvesting. Professionals visiting the area can expect a landscape dominated by medium to large-sized family farms and increasing modernization in agricultural techniques and machinery.
